Continuing with the tradition of posting songs relating to holidays I don't actually care about, here's two topical tracks, one happy and one not-so-much: Toshack Highway, "Valentine Number One" and Girls Against Boys, "My Funny Valentine". The former is a solo project by Adam Franklin of Swervedriver doing a sort of mellow electronic-tinged pop thing, not totally unlike the Postal Service. The latter is by a then-fashionable NYC post-grunge band from a 1993 Sinatra tribute album; some covers sound too much like the original, but this maybe goes to the other extreme. Still, I like it.
